On the second day of the Incheon Asian Games, India bagged a Bronze medal in Shooting this morning, the second day of the events. The trio of Jitu Rai, Samresh Jung and Prakash Nanjappa finished third in the Men's 10-metre Air Pistol Team event to give India it's first medal of the day. This is India's third medal of the Incheon Games, and all have come in Shooting. Jitu Rai had bagged the country's first Gold of the Games yesterday finishing at the top of the podium in the 50-metre Pistol event. Shweta Chaudhary had won the Bronze in the Women's 10-metre Air Pistol event. Jitu Rai, however, had to face elimination in the Men's 10-metre Air Pistol Individual Finals today. He ended at the fifth spot. He had advanced to the finals after finishing second in the qualification. India shooters could not make a mark in the Men's Trap events.The squash has assured 2 medals today. In the Men's Singles event Sourav Ghoshal defeated Pakistan's Nasir Iqbal 3-1 in the five setter game to be placed in last 4, thus guaranteeing India a medal. In Women's singles Dipika Pallikal registered victory over compatriot Joshana Chinappa 3-2 in the quarter finals. Hence, another medal assured from the event. The Indian Women's Badminton team is taking on Hosts South Korea in the semi-finals. India was even at 1-1 in the team event.In Tennis, the Indian Men's Team progressed into the quarterfinals. It defeated Nepal in the second round. Yesterday Indian Women's team had advanced to the next round beating Oman 3-Nil.Indian Men's Hockey team defeated SriLanka in the pool match fixture, 8-nil. India will next play Oman in another Pool Match. The Women's team will kick start their campaign tomorrow against Thailand.In handball, the men's team lost to South Korea 19-39 in Group preliminary round.Indian swimmers fail to qualify for the finals of the three events. Saurabh Sangvekar ended fifth in the men's 200m freestyle heat with a timing of 1:53.33. In the men's 100m backstroke heats, Madhu Nair clocked 57.81 to finish seventh. In men's 200m butterfly event, Agnel Dsouza finished a creditable fourth with a timing of 2:04.74.In the Basketball court India faced defeat from the hands of Saudi Arabia 67-73 in Qualifying Round Group match.In Football – India women's team suffers a crushing 10-0 defeat against Thailand in Group A match.Cycling Track saw – Deborah and Mohan Mahitha finish ninth and 11th, respectively, in women's keirin individual track event.
